BAKU, Azerbaijan, May 25. The delegation of Turkmenistan, headed by the Minister of Finance and Economy Mukhammetgeldi Serdarov, took part in the 78th annual session of the United Nations Economic and Social Commission for Asia and the Pacific (ESCAP) in Bangkok, the capital of Thailand, Trend reports citing Orient news.

The theme of this year's session is "A common agenda to advance sustainable development in Asia and the Pacific".

Speaking at the event, the Finance Minister recalled that Turkmenistan, within the framework of the sessions of the UN General Assembly, took the initiative to organize another international conference on financing for development.

At this stage, Turkmenistan is moving to the use of modern environmentally friendly and resource-saving technologies in the field of industry and transport, Serdarov noted.

On the sidelines of the 78th session, the Turkmen Minister met with ESCAP Executive Secretary Armida Salsiah Alisjahbana, expressing readiness to continue to interact with the organization on the issues of the sustainable development agenda.

The parties discussed the mobilization of domestic financial resources, and the use of bonds to attract funds for sustainable development and highly appreciated the cooperation of Turkmenistan and ESCAP in the implementation of a number of projects, including the construction of the Kazakhstan-Turkmenistan-Iran railway.
